Anyone else have an issue when the weather is raining and you turn your defroster on and it doesn't clear up. I tried going from hot to cold recirculate to non recirculate and even turning on the a/c. No luck. clean the windows then tried rainex defog. works for about a week then comes back % rather annoying. Asked the dealer about it and the manager says his demo does the same thing. asked service, no recalls. My wife had the same thing with 2004 camry But I couyld get around it by playing with the a/c to clear it and temp. Anyone having simular issues ? Steve

Replying to: sotoloff (Oct 31, 2007 6:58 pm) Turning on the A/C should also take out the moisture since it should condense on the evaporator coils and drain out of the car. |
